ABOUT
FITA ACADEMY
FITA is a leading Skill development
and Placement company
managed by IT veterans with
more than two decades of experience
in leading MNC companies. We
GREAT
are known for our practical
approach towards trainings that FUTURE
enable students to gain real-time
exposure on competitive technologies
& Foreign Languages.
STARTS
Transforming Students & IT
Professionals into FROM
Industry-Ready Workforce
since 2012!
HERE
Since
2
120+ 75,000+
COURSES STUDENTS
1000+
EXPERT
TRAINERS
0 PLACEMENT
SUPPORT
100%
1500+
1 15+
PLACEMENT
TIEUPS 2
Classroom Locations
BRANCHES*
Chennai Bangalore Coimbatore Madurai Pondicherry
*Includes all the group companies
300+ Corporate Clients
OUR STUDENTS
WORKS AT:
Why Learn Data Analytics - Sql Power BI at FITA Academy:
Live Capstone Projects
Real time Industry Experts as Trainers
Placement Support till you get your Dream Job offer!
Free Interview Clearing Workshops
Free Resume Preparation & Aptitude Workshops
Students at Placement Workshop:
DATA ANALYTICS - SQL & POWER BI
Data Analytics Fundamentals:
What is Data Analytics?
Data Analytics vs Data Science vs AI?
Why is Data Analytics Important?
Where is Data Analytics used
Future of Data Analytics
Opportunities in Data Analytics
Popular Tools for Data Analytics - Tableau, Power BI and
FITA Academy
Other data analytics tools
Role of SQL in Data Analytics
Importance of Statistics
Structured Query Language:
SQL Introduction
SQL Basic Overview
Query Language
SQL Server
MySQL
Oracle Database
SQL Database User
SQL*Plus
Connect with System User
Create a new Database User
Log into new User
SQL Database
Create Database
Delete or Drop Database
Use Database
FITA Academy
Create Database in SQL Server
Rename Database
SQL Table
Create table
Create Table in SQL Server
Delete or Drop table
Insert Data into table
Select Distinct
Select Top
Where Clause
Aliases
Update Table
AND, OR, NOT
IN
Between
Order By
Group By
Rank
Dense_Rank
Having
Exists
ANY and ALL
CASE Statement
Select Into
Alter Table
FITA Academy
Order of execution of a Query
SQL Constraints
Constraints Introduction
Not Null
Unique
Primary Key
Foreign Key
Check
Default
Index
Auto Increment Field
Cascading referential integrity constraint
Identity Column in SQL Server
SQL Keywords
Keywords Introduction
SQL Data Types
Data Types Introduction
SQL Operators
Operators Introduction
SQL Wildcard Characters
Wildcard Introduction
Like
FITA Academy
SQL Joins
Joins Introduction
Inner Join
Left Join
Right Join
Full Join
Self Join
Union
Cross Join
Advanced Join
SQL Aggregate Function
Introduction
Min
Max
Count
Avg
Sum
SQL Views
Views Introduction
Advantages of View
Updateable Views
Limitations of views
SQL Dates
Dates Introduction
SQL Stored Procedures
Stored Procedures Introduction
FITA Academy
SQL Functions
Functions Introduction
Table Valued Functions
Scalar Valued Functions
Stored Procedure VS Function
Multi-Statement Table Valued Functions
Function WITH ENCRYPTION
Function WITH SCHEMABINDING
String Functions in SQL Server
Ascii()
Char()
Ltrim()
Rtrim()
Lower()
Upper()
Reverse()
Len()
Left()
Right()
CharIndex()
Replace()
Stuff()
SQL Server Date Functions
ISDATE()
DAY()
FITA Academy
MONTH()
YEAR()
DATENAME()
DATEPART()
DATEADD ()
DATEDIFF()
Real time Example
Other Functions in SQL Server
Cast()
Convert()
Mathematical Functions in SQL Server
Mathematical Functions
Backup and Restore
Backup in SQL Server
Database Restore
Mastering POWER BI
INTRODUCTION TO POWER BI
Why Use Power BI?
Power BI Desktop Power BI Pro vs. Free
Explanation of ETL process (Extract, Transform, Load)
Data Types
CREATING POWER BI REPORTS, AUTO FILTERS
Report Design with Database Tables
Understanding Power BI Report Designer
FITA Academy
Report Canvas, Report Pages: Creation, Renames
Report Visuals, Fields and UI Options
Experimenting Visual Interactions, Advantages
Reports with Multiple Pages and Advantages
Pages with Multiple Visualizations.
Data Access PUBLISH Options and Report Verification in Cloud
"GET DATA" Options and Report Fields, Filters
Report View Options: Full, Fit Page, Width Scale
Stacked bar chart, Stacked column chart Clustered bar
chart, Clustered column chart
Adding Report Titles. Report Format Options
Focus Mode, Explore and Export Settings
REPORT VISUALIZATIONS and PROPERTIES
Power BI Design: Canvas, Visualizations and Fields
Import Data Options with Power BI Model, Advantages
Data Fields and Filters with Visualizations
Visualization Filters, Page Filters, Report Filters
Conditional Filters and Clearing. Testing Sets
Creating Customized Tables with Power BI Editor
General Properties, Sizing, Dimensions, and Positions
Alternate Text and Tiles. Header (Column, Row) Properties
FITA Academy
Grid Properties (Vertical, Horizontal) and Styles
Table Styles & Alternate Row Colors - Static, Dynamic
Sparse, Flashy Rows, Condensed Table Reports. Focus Mode
Total Computations, Background. Borders Properties
Column Headers, Column Formatting, Value Properties
Conditional Formatting Options - Color Scale
Page Level Filters and Report Level Filters
Visual-Level Filters and Format Options
Report Fields, Formats and Analytics
Page-Level Filters and Column Formatting, Filters
Background Properties, Borders and Lock Aspect
CHART AND MAP REPORT PROPERTIES
Chart report types and properties
Stacked bar chart, stacked column chart
Clustered bar chart, clustered column chart
100% stacked bar chart, 100% stacked column chart
Line charts, area charts, stacked area charts
Line and stacked row charts line and stacked column charts
waterfall chart, scatter chart, pie chart
Field Properties: Axis, Legend, Value, Tooltip
FITA Academy
Field Properties: Color Saturation, Filters Types
Formats: Legend, Axis, Data Labels, Plot Area
Data Labels: Visibility, Color and Display Units
Data Labels: Precision, Position, Text Options
Analytics: Constant Line, Position, Labels
Working with Waterfall Charts and Default Values
Modifying Legends and Visual Filters - Options
Map Reports: Working with Map Reports
Hierarchies: Grouping Multiple Report Fields
Hierarchy Levels and Usages in Visualizations
Pre Ordered Attribute Collection - Advantages
Using Field Hierarchies with Chart Reports
HIERARCHIES and DRILLDOWN REPORTS
Hierarchies and Drill Down Options
Hierarchy Levels and Drill Modes - Usage
Drill-thru Options with Tree Map and Pie Chart
Higher Levels and Next Level Navigation Options
Aggregates with Bottom/Up Navigations. Rules
Multi Field Aggregations and Hierarchies in Power BI
EXTRACTING & TRANSFORMING DATA
Extracting data from various sources: Text/CSV files,
FITA Academy
Excel worksheets, Multiple Files in a Folder, and more
Transforming data using the Power Query Editor:
ETL = Extract, Transform, Load
ELT = Extract, Load, Transform
DATA TRANSFORMATIONS
Use First Row as Headers
Remove Empty rows (null data)
Split Column By Delimiter
Applied Steps
Merge Queries
Append Queries
Fill Down
Transpose
Pivot
Column profiling for data quality check
Query Dependencies
RELATIONSHIPS
Relationship importance
Understanding types of relationship
Creating relationships
Cross filter relation: Single or Both
BUILDING/DESIGN A REPORT
Adding a Title
FITA Academy
Adding a Logo
Adding a Background (Solid Color or Photo)
DAX & MEASURES
Create Measures
Using Measures in a Data Visualization
Calculated Columns
Using DAX to create a Calculated Column
Navigating Related Tables using DAX
SLICERS
What Slicers Are
Adding & Using a Slicer
CAPSTONE PROJECT - 1
Retail Sales Analysis and Forecasting Using Python,
SQL, and Power BI
Project Description:
This capstone project aims to provide hands-on experience
in data analytics by combining the power of Python, SQL,
and Power BI to analyze and forecast retail sales. The
project will cover the entire analytics lifecycle, from data
extraction and preprocessing to advanced analysis,
visualization, and predictive modeling.
FITA Academy
Part 1: Data Extraction and Preparation
1. Project Overview and Data Understanding
Introduction to the retail sales dataset, which includes
sales transactions, product information, and customer
data.
Objectives: To analyze sales trends, identify key drivers
of sales, and forecast future sales.
2. Data Extraction with SQL
Task: Connect to the retail database using SQL Server.
Practical Session: Write SQL queries to extract data
from various tables (e.g., sales, products, customers).
3. Data Cleaning and Transformation with Python
Task: Clean and preprocess the extracted data
using Python.
Practical Session: Use Pandas for data cleaning
(handling missing values, data type conversion, and
normalization).
Part 2: Data Analysis and Visualization
1. Exploratory Data Analysis (EDA) with Python
Task: Perform EDA to understand sales trends
FITA Academy
and patterns.
Practical Session: Use Matplotlib and Seaborn to
visualize sales trends, seasonal patterns, and outliers.
2. Data Loading into SQL Database
Task: Load the cleaned data back into the SQL
database.
Practical Session: Use SQLAlchemy to facilitate the
data transfer from Python to SQL.
3. Advanced SQL Queries for Analysis
Task: Write advanced SQL queries to derive insights
from the data.
Practical Session: Use GROUP BY, JOIN, and subqueries
to analyze sales by region, product category, and
customer segment.
4. Creating Interactive Dashboards with Power BI
Task: Import the processed data from SQL Server
into Power BI.
Practical Session:
Connect Power BI to the SQL database.
Create interactive dashboards to visualize sales
performance, product trends, and customer
behavior.
Use various Power BI features like slicers, filters,
and drill-through functionalities.
FITA Academy
Part 3: Predictive Modeling and Forecasting
1. Sales Forecasting with Python
Task: Develop a sales forecasting model using
historical sales data.
Practical Session:
Use time series analysis and machine learning
techniques (e.g., ARIMA, Prophet, or LSTM) to
predict future sales.
Evaluate model performance using metrics such
as MAE and RMSE.
2. Integrating Forecasting Results into Power BI
Task: Visualize the forecasting results in Power BI.
Practical Session:
Import the forecasting results from Python into
Power BI.
Create a new dashboard to display the sales
forecasts alongside historical sales data.
Final Project: Comprehensive Retail Sales
Analysis Report
1. Compilation of Insights
FITA Academy
Task: Summarize the findings from the data analysis
and forecasting phases.
Practical Session:
Create a comprehensive report that includes
key insights, visualizations, and forecasts.
Use Power BI to design an executive summary
dashboard.
2. Presentation of Results
Task: Present the final analysis and recommendations
to stakeholders.
Practical Session:
Prepare a presentation that highlights the key
findings, visualizations, and actionable insights.
Demonstrate the interactive Power BI dashboards
and discuss the forecasting results.
By completing this capstone project, participants will gain
practical experience in integrating Python, SQL, and Power BI
to perform end-to-end data analytics. They will be equipped
with the skills needed to analyze complex datasets, create
FITA Academy
insightful visualizations, and make data-driven decisions,
making them valuable assets in any data-driven organization.
Follow FITA Academy in
Instagram for More Updates
FITA Academy
@fita_academy